Infrastructure-free normalization engine in Core dispatching on MeterMode: - Cumulative/Generation counters: register deltas, first-reading baseline (Haus 411, Auto 3755), meter swaps (water …861→2 reconciles to 12 via boundary registers OR an explicit amount override), counter resets, anomaly-guarded decreases. - RuntimeCounter: Δhours × rate (fixed/empirical). - ConsumableBalance: tank level-Δ + deliveries → consumption, cm→litre calibration; delivery-only rows before the first dipstick emit nothing. - DirectDelta, and Virtual meters via a small safe arithmetic evaluator (Netz Einsparung = Haus − Netz, Eigenverbrauch = Erzeugung − Einsparung) — data-driven, not hardcoded. - DatabaseSeeder: default energy types, cost categories, base settings (idempotent). 24 Core unit tests + 4 integration tests green.
